Output e8afb718311a8c8b2b25d41b9d38e5f083f7560af93b0244bdf9f2f5b87c9780:0

value
150000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ed52401d4f882db13229eacc18a08039a922e7d9 OP_EQUAL
address
3PKrbsLz4PQno2jbvg3U3XNAWswSnzEDof
transaction
e8afb718311a8c8b2b25d41b9d38e5f083f7560af93b0244bdf9f2f5b87c9780
spent
true